Originated at Face, in 5 weights. [Berthold 1974] Credited to Tony Geddes, 1968, as Musketeer. [Reichardt/Hoefer] Also shown by Typeshop as Milton in 5 weights, with alternates for ‘AHMV’ [Typeshop c. 1977], and later as Milton Serial in 6 weights plus outlined as well as outlined and shaded styles. 3 weights were adopted by Mecanorma and listed as “new” in 1988, with QBF credit (Quick Brown Fox = Brendel) [Mecanorma 1988].
One weight is offered by Mecanorma in digital form as Milton. For other digital versions, see Musketeer and Melbourne.
